Stella McCartney Stella Eau De Parfum 30ml – £46
I’ve had Stella by Stella McCartney for a while now. It’s one of my every day perfumes that I usually wear during the day time for the office. It’s quite a light fragrance I think, it definitely lasts a long time on clothes / the skin but it doesn’t project so much so I can’t see it offending any noses if you’re stuck in the lift with some colleagues.
It’s a rose-based scent but the inclusion of citrus notes keeps it from being too sweet and cloying and the amber adds some warmth. I find some rose scents can be a bit older and soapy, but this manages to be quite a young scent – definitely a twist on the typical rose perfumes you get.
The glass Stella McCartney’s Stella is housed in is ethically sourced, as are all the ingredients. It’s definitely one for the eco-conscious, or as a gift for friends who want to be environmentally friendly.
According to experts the notes are:
Top notes: Mandarin, Rose, Peony
Heart notes: Rose absolute
Base notes: Woody ambers
It’s definitely an option for someone who likes floral scents which are not so sweet.
